Gene Maddaus Senior Media WriterEarlier this year, a Chinese VFX and animation studio revealed that it had been victimized by two American swindlers who had used the company’s name to defraud investors out of $234 million.In a filing on Thursday, the company alleged that the two men — Remington Chase and Kevin Robl — are still trying to lure investors, even after the scam was exposed.
The company, Base, filed for an injunction that would block the men from using its name to solicit further investments.The whereabouts of Robl and Chase remain uncertain.
They could not be reached for comment, and they have yet to respond to the federal lawsuit that Base filed against them in March.
In the suit, CEO Chris Bremble alleged that he had been the victim of a con stretching back nine years, in which Robl and Chase gradually gained his trust and then used the relationship to scam investors.
